Domain of the function are the real values at which the function is defined, or has a unique value. generally domain is represented by the values that x - coordinate can take according to graph.

So, domain of given function is :

  • [ -5, 1 )

here,

  • [ ] represents closed interval - that means it can have the extreme values too.

  • ( ) represents open interval - that means it can have values between extremes but not extreme value.

Similarly, range represents all the values that the function can have, and it is represented by the values that y - coordinate can have.

So, range of given function is :

  • [ -4, 7 )
